The school halloween party was good fun and I am a particular fan of their version of russian roulette. They made おにぎり(Onigiri- Rice ball) with a mixture of different fillings ranging from pickled plum, chocolate and jam mixed with margarine.

Am I the only one thinking that cow is staring creepily at me?

Oh and the best one, wasabi, lots and lots of wasabi. Out of 25 onigiri, 4 of them had wasabi in them, and you will never guess who got one of those, 4/25 odds, wasabi onigiri. Here is a hint, have you ever seen a monkey cry?

I was talking to my friend who comes with me every Tuesday, I mentioned the blog and one of the servers overheard me and asked "Burogu?" (Blog?) and I said "Hai, burogu" (Yes, blog) and he said "Anketo" (Questionnaire). Pretty sure he said more words than this but my Japanese isn't good enough to catch or remember anything else (The quote for me is pretty much verbatim). Then he showed me this:

It's sad when a Japanese persons English is written in better handwriting then you own!

I am not 100% on what that says but it says something like "I read/heard about this place from a blog i read called "1 month of ramen" by a British man called Steve. It was delicious" So to you mystery man/woman (They wouldn't show me the name, there is a lot of secrecy in the ramen world....Have I said too much???) thank you very much for both showing me that real people read my blog.
